单词 papponymic
释义

papponymicn.adj.

Brit. /ˌpapəˈnɪmɪk/, U.S. /ˌpæpəˈnɪmɪk/
Origin: A borrowing from Greek, combined with an English element. Etymons: Greek πάππος , -onymic comb. form.
Etymology: < ancient Greek πάππος grandfather (see pappus n.) + -onymic comb. form, after patronymic n. Compare matronymic n., metronymic n.
rare.
A personal or family name derived from that of a grandfather. Also as adj.

1875 M. A. Lower Eng. Surnames (ed. 4) II. vii. 73 Those who assumed the latter [sc. Mac] adopted the father's name or Patronymic, while those who took the former [sc. O'], chose the designation of the grandfather, the Papponymic.
1985 Amer. Jrnl. Philol. 106 135 The hypothesis that the -sla forms are papponymic apparently leads to the mistranslation.
1996 D. Ogden Greek Bastardy x. 311 Members of the tribe were to be reregistered with their patronymic, metronymic, and their maternal papponymic (i.e. the name of their mother's father).
